Electronic observation tools for the classroom  [home link]

I highly recommend this innovative new classroom observation software. eCOVE removes the guess work and opinion from the classroom observation process. It captures and combines empirical data to give a far more accurate view of classroom behavior than any other software tool on the market.

Research Based
eCOVE’s data collection is formulated around research based indicators. The result is an informed, and accurate view of the classroom that promote conclusions based on useful data. eCOVE’s data collection tools include those most commonly used for classroom observation, and even has the unique ability to allow you to custom design your own data gathering tools.

Supports Standards
The twenty-three eCOVE tools provide data to support evaluation and decisions based on district and national standards. Multiple tools can be used with each standard to provide a factual basis for making and defending the judgments required in any standards-based system.

Collects Data and Comments
In addition to the suite of counters and timers, users can also record comments by way of an ever present comments window. Each comment is time stamped and the name of the tool currently open is automatically generated. The observer comments are saved as a separate report and allow for additional comments and suggestions.

A Powerful Tool
Both the collected data and observer comments are included in the generated reports, and will facilitate collaborative solutions for a variety of problems. It’s easy to view, save, print or email the electronic documents, providing an effective record keeping system.

Platforms:
Windows
Macintosh OS 9
Macintosh OS X
Palm OS
Pocket PC
